Can I install programs via .deb files?

Booting, installing, newbie
Post Reply
Message
Author
doublepuppy
Posts: 1
Joined: Sun 14 Jun 2020, 16:24

Can I install programs via .deb files?

#1 Post by doublepuppy »

The question is in the title

foxpup
Posts: 1132
Joined: Fri 29 Jul 2016, 21:08

#2 Post by foxpup »

Welcome to Puppyland doublepuppy!

This is a strange way to put your question.
You've made a poll of it.

Yes, you can install through .deb files.
You just click them.

However, this is not the preferred way. Possibilities are:
. If there is Quickpet in your Puppy, you use that if it has what you need.
. sfsget in terminal may give you .sfs file (for big programs)
. Except for big programs, like full blown browsers or offices, you use PPM, Puppy package manager. It uses package repositories and looks for missing dependencies.
. You look on the forum if someone has made a package of the program to work properly for your Puppy
. You download a package (.deb, .rpm, .tgz ...) from the maker of the program and install by clicking it
. resolve missing dependencies through PPM preferably
. you download the source for the program, the dev.sfs for your puppy (with sfsget) and start compiling yourself

More or less in this order.

O.F.I.N.S.I.S.
Posts: 159
Joined: Sun 01 Mar 2020, 16:17

#3 Post by O.F.I.N.S.I.S. »

I just voted "no, you can't". :lol:
Our Future Is Not Set In Stone
[url]https://www.youtube.com/channel/UCyfyaxCNMduwyXlQFRQKhhQ[/url]
[url]https://soundcloud.com/user-633698367[/url]
[b]My own build of Bionic64[/b]

User avatar
fabrice_035
Posts: 765
Joined: Mon 28 Apr 2014, 17:54
Location: Bretagne / France

#4 Post by fabrice_035 »

Yes, you can install it, but will it work?
Bionicpup64-8.0 _ Kernel 5.4.27-64oz _ Asus Rog GL752

User avatar
Flash
Official Dog Handler
Posts: 13071
Joined: Wed 04 May 2005, 16:04
Location: Arizona USA

#5 Post by Flash »

It won't work in Windows. Doublepuppy doesn't say what OS he's using, so I can't do any better than that.

User avatar
bigpup
Posts: 13886
Joined: Sun 11 Oct 2009, 18:15
Location: S.C. USA

#6 Post by bigpup »

General answer yes.

But like all Linux software, the deb package has to be compiled for a OS that is similar to the Puppy version being used.
The two OS's will be using similar support files.

PPM uses a lot of deb packages. But it also tries to get any dependency files/programs, it needs to work.
It accesses repositories, that have deb packages, requiring similar support files, as what are in the Puppy version.

If you just download a deb package and click on it to install.
Good chance it will be missing some needed dependency stuff.
That stuff will have to be added.
If lucky, it will have everything needed and just work.
The things they do not tell you, are usually the clue to solving the problem.
When I was a kid I wanted to be older.... This is not what I expected :shock:
YaPI(any iso installer)

Post Reply